Что означают JavaScript-Object-Notation а-также XML-формат
Что означают JavaScript-Object-Notation а-также XML-формат
JSON-формат плюс XML являют из-себя стандарты пересылки информацией, они задействуются для отправки информации для несколькими программами. Они используются во web-разработке, интеграции систем, работе через интерфейсами-API а-также размещении структурированных сведений. Ключевая цель данных структур заключается в том, с-целью создать понятный а-также типовой метод передачи информации.
В цифровой среде данные обязаны отправляться среди приложениями а-также серверными-частями, при-этом еще для несколькими сервисами. В практических сценариях а-также практических разборах, включая https://moreleto-anapa.ru/, регулярно демонстрируется, как JavaScript-Object-Notation и XML-формат задействуются для настройки передачи информацией, синхронизации информации и обмена для сервисами.
Что такое JSON
JSON-формат, то-есть JS объектная Notation, представляет по-сути компактный формат информации, построенный на-основе схеме объектов и списков. JSON использует 1xbet текстовый способ, который легко читается и анализируется и специалистом, так и программами. JavaScript-Object-Notation часто применяется в web-приложениях и API.
Данные во JavaScript-Object-Notation структурированы внутри формате комбинаций «ключ–значение». Поле задает собой имя поля, при-этом значение может выступать символьным-значением, цифровым-значением, boolean типом, набором а-также дочерним объектом. Такая структура делает JSON-формат подходящим ради размещения плюс передачи данных.
JSON-формат выделяется компактностью и простотой. Данный-формат не нуждается-в сложных правил структурирования, из-за-этого JSON легче задействовать во сопоставлении со иными форматами. Такая-особенность делает JSON востребованным выбором 1хбет ради нынешних приложений.
Какое представляет Extensible-Markup-Language
Extensible-Markup-Language, либо Extensible markup язык, представляет из-себя стандарт описания, он используется ради сохранения плюс передачи информации. Он основан вокруг использовании разметочных-тегов, что задают организацию информации. Extensible-Markup-Language помогает задавать собственные элементы плюс указывать тегов значения.
Информация во XML-формате заключаются в теги, которые содержат открывающую а-также финальную секцию. Подобная организация делает данный-стандарт значительно строгим плюс строгим. XML применяется в различных решениях, когда необходима точное описание структуры сведений 1х бет.
Extensible-Markup-Language характеризуется гибкостью а-также расширяемостью. XML позволяет описывать сложные схемы плюс использовать атрибуты для конкретизации параметров. Это создает формат удобным ради задач, где нужна строгая организация данных.
Основные расхождения JavaScript-Object-Notation плюс XML
JSON-формат и XML-формат выполняют схожую роль, однако имеют различные модели к описанию данных. JSON-формат использует значительно лаконичный способ-записи а-также меньший-объем символов, это формирует его кратким. XML требует увеличенное-число служебных частей, что расширяет размер сведений.
JavaScript-Object-Notation удобнее разбирается а-также быстрее интерпретируется в основной-части актуальных сервисов. XML-формат, со отдельную сторону, обеспечивает расширенные средств с-целью задания организации плюс валидации информации. Выбор 1xbet для ними определяется на-основе требований отдельной системы.
Также меняется механизм взаимодействия с сведениями. JavaScript-Object-Notation регулярнее применяется в онлайн-сервисах и API, в-то-время как XML-формат используется для корпоративных системах, технических-файлах и пересылке упорядоченной информацией.
Схема JavaScript-Object-Notation
JSON-формат строится с-помощью структур плюс списков. Элемент формирует собой комплект комбинаций ключ-значение, заключенных во фигурные символы. Список обозначает по-сути список данных, помещенных в служебные скобки.
Каждое поле во JSON имеет-возможность быть базовым либо сложным. Простые 1хбет элементы содержат строки, показатели плюс boolean типы. Сложные данные включают наборы и внутренние объекты. Подобная схема позволяет представлять сложные данные.
JSON-формат не предусматривает комментарии и жесткую типизацию, что облегчает JSON задействование. При-этом данная-особенность требует аккуратности во-время работе со сведениями, чтобы предотвратить ошибок.
Организация Extensible-Markup-Language
Extensible-Markup-Language применяет многоуровневую схему, построенную на вложенных тегах. Каждый элемент получает имя и может 1х бет содержать сведения а-также вложенные теги. Такая-структура дает-возможность описывать сложные схемы информации.
Блоки XML имеют-возможность включать атрибуты, они конкретизируют сведения. Атрибуты записываются в-рамках открывающего блока и формируют расширенный уровень уточнения.
Extensible-Markup-Language предполагает точного следования правил оформления. Каждые блоки необходимо оставаться оформлены, и организация обязана считаться валидной. Такая-особенность формирует формат намного регламентированным, при-этом обеспечивает стабильность сведений.
Области-применения JSON
JSON-формат широко применяется во web-разработке. JSON 1xbet задействуется для отправки информации среди приложением плюс backend, при-этом также ради работы со интерфейсами-API. За-счет данной понятности данный-формат считается стандартом в современных сервисах.
JSON-формат используется во mobile приложениях, платформах анализа а-также интеграции систем. Он позволяет быстро отправлять данные а-также анализировать данные без сложных обработок.
Кроме-того JSON-формат используется ради сохранения конфигураций плюс параметров. Формат схема создает его практичным ради описания настроек плюс их последующего 1хбет использования.
Использование XML
XML-формат применяется для системах, в-которых необходима формальная организация данных. Данный-формат применяется в корпоративных решениях, пересылке данными плюс связке разных систем.
XML часто применяется для регламентах обмена данными, вроде например конфигурационные документы, документы и отчеты. Его расширяемость помогает адаптировать схему под-задачи различные случаи.
Дополнительно Extensible-Markup-Language задействуется во платформах, когда важна проверка информации. Имеются специальные структуры, что позволяют проверять правильность схемы плюс содержимого.
Плюсы а-также ограничения
JSON-формат обладает ряд преимуществ, среди-которых понятность, малый-объем плюс эффективность обработки. Данный-формат подходит ради разработчиков и эффективно применяется с-целью нынешних сервисов. Тем-не-менее 1х бет его инструменты задания организации ограничены.
XML-формат предоставляет более широкие инструменты для задания данных. Он включает описания, параметры а-также строгую структуру. Такая-особенность создает формат подходящим ради многоуровневых решений, при-этом расширяет объем данных плюс нагрузку интерпретации.
Выбор для JavaScript-Object-Notation плюс Extensible-Markup-Language формируется с-учетом условий. Если требуется скорость а-также понятность, обычно применяется JSON-формат. Когда необходима строгая схема а-также контроль сведений, используется Extensible-Markup-Language.
Обработка JavaScript-Object-Notation и XML-формата
Для работы через JavaScript-Object-Notation а-также XML применяются профильные средства а-также пакеты. Такие-инструменты помогают получать, формировать плюс конвертировать информацию. В многих языков разработки доступна стандартная совместимость указанных 1xbet форматов.
Обработка JavaScript-Object-Notation чаще-всего оперативнее, поскольку как данного-формата структура легче. XML требует больше вычислений из-за развитой структуры а-также потребности проверки разметки.
Конвертация данных между форматами еще допустимо. Такая-возможность помогает интегрировать платформы, применяющие разные стандарты. Подобные процессы часто проводятся автоматически посредством помощью профильных модулей 1хбет.
Функция JavaScript-Object-Notation и Extensible-Markup-Language для актуальных системах
JSON плюс XML-формат являются важными элементами электронной экосистемы. Данные-стандарты обеспечивают передачу данными между системами а-также позволяют создавать подключения. В-случае-отсутствия этих форматов взаимодействие для платформами становилось-бы бы существенно сложнее.
JSON стал основным стандартом для онлайн-сервисов и интерфейсов-API за-счет своей простоте а-также практичности. XML поддерживает отдельную значимость для решениях, где нужна четкая структура а-также валидация данных.
Указанные варианта продолжают задействоваться а-также развиваться. Данные-форматы сохраняются ключевыми механизмами с-целью пересылки информации а-также создания электронных 1х бет решений.
Вспомогательные аспекты форматов
JavaScript-Object-Notation и XML-формат выделяются не-исключительно исключительно синтаксисом, однако плюс принципом к обработке со данными. JSON обычно используется в-качестве формат пересылки, тогда как Extensible-Markup-Language может задействоваться в-качестве с-целью отправки, так-же а-также для сохранения данных. Это обусловлено из-за данной-причиной, что XML-формат позволяет описывать намного развитые структуры плюс регламенты контроля.
Внутри JSON-формате не-предусмотрена возможность заметок, это создает JSON значительно лаконичным в-плане стороны оценки организации. В XML-формате 1xbet комментарии поддерживаются, данный-фактор облегчает пояснение данных. Тем-не-менее это также повышает массу и имеет-возможность затруднять разбор.
Еще значимой деталью считается зависимость ко регистру. В JavaScript-Object-Notation ключи чувствительны к регистру, данный-фактор требует контроля при обработке. Во XML-формате еще необходимо контролировать правильное обозначение тегов, так как ошибка в имени может привести к некорректной обработке.
Скорость плюс эффективность
JSON-формат как-правило интерпретируется оперативнее, поскольку как данного-формата организация проще плюс предполагает меньше операций. Это 1хбет особенно необходимо при взаимодействии при крупными массивами данных плюс повышенными интенсивностями. JSON регулярно используется для платформах, когда критична оперативность ответа.
Extensible-Markup-Language требует больше мощностей ради интерпретации, так как требуется анализировать структуру разметки а-также проверять элементов корректность. Тем-не-менее данная-особенность уравновешивается возможностью строгой проверки сведений плюс адаптивностью организации.
Во-время выборе структуры критично оценивать требования системы. Когда главным-фактором является оперативность и малый-объем, чаще задействуется JSON-формат. Когда критична формальность а-также контроль информации, используется 1х бет Extensible-Markup-Language.